Removal of biofilms formed on ion-exchange membranes in ultrafiltration permeates of secondary dairy raw materials
The modelling of biofilm development on MK-40 and MA-41Π ion-exchange membrane coupons was conducted in skim milk, sweet whey and acid whey ultrafiltration permeates.
